Live from NPR News in Washington, on Corvo Coleman, thousands of people gathered at Michigan

0:04.7

State University's campus last night to honor the lives of three students killed in a mass

0:08.9

shooting earlier this week.

0:10.9

Five more students were critically injured.

0:13.0

From Member Station WKAR, Mellory Begey reports.

0:17.2

Students were encouraged to grieve and look out for one another as they continued to process

0:21.4

the shooting that left three dead and five others hospitalized.

0:25.5

Governor Gretchen Whitmer, in MSU alum, spoke at the gathering.

0:29.0

I will do everything in my power to make sure that those we've lost are not just numbers

0:34.8

or stories to be forgotten a week or month from now.

0:37.5

Whitmer said the state is in a unique position to take action to save lives.

0:42.0

Legislative Democrats say they're working on proposals.

0:45.2

For NPR News, I'm Mellory Begey.

Two people have been arrested after a deadly shooting yesterday at a mall in El Paso, Texas.

0:52.7

One person was killed and three others were injured.

0:55.3

Police insist there is no further danger to the public.

0:58.6

The shopping mall is next to a Walmart that was the scene of a mass shooting in 2019.

1:03.9

A white government who is a white supremacist killed 23 people then, saying that he wanted

1:08.9

to target Latinos.

1:10.7

That government has pleaded guilty to scores of federal charges.
